📊 Digital Marketing Specialist Salary Overview — Oklahoma City 2026
In 2026, the average annual salary for a Digital Marketing Specialist in Oklahoma City is typically in the range of $55,000 to $73,000, depending on experience, skills, and industry demand. Entry‑level professionals may start near $45,000, while seasoned specialists or those in leadership roles may earn over $80,000 annually.
| Experience Level | Typical Salary Range (2026) |
|---|---|
| Entry‑Level (0‑2 years) | $45,000 – $55,000 |
| Mid‑Level (2‑5 years) | $55,000 – $68,000 |
| Senior (5+ years) | $68,000 – $83,000 |
| Management/Lead Roles | $80,000+ |
Oklahoma City remains an affordable and growing market, making its average salary competitive within the region while balancing a lower cost of living than many U.S. metros.
💡 Key Factors That Influence Salary
Multiple elements affect how much a Digital Marketing Specialist earns, including:
1. Experience & Role Complexity
More experienced specialists with a proven track record of campaign strategy and performance results command higher pay.
Leadership or managerial responsibilities — such as overseeing a team or shaping strategy — often come with salary premiums.
2. Education & Technical Skills
Degrees in Marketing, Communications, Business, or related fields can be advantageous.
Specialized skills like SEO, PPC, analytics (Google Analytics, Tableau), and marketing automation boost market value.
3. Certifications That Can Elevate Pay
Professional certifications demonstrate expertise and often correlate with higher wages:
Google Analytics Certified
Google Ads Certification
Facebook Blueprint
HubSpot Content Marketing Certification
Digital Marketing Institute Certified Digital Marketing Professional
Certified professionals often see salary increases of 10%–20% compared to non‑certified peers.
4. Industry & Company Size
Digital Marketing Specialists in larger companies or in sectors like healthcare, tech, or finance tend to earn above the city’s average. In smaller businesses, generalist roles may offer broader responsibilities but slightly lower pay.

📍 Salary Comparison — Oklahoma City vs Neighboring Markets
Understanding how Oklahoma City compares to other cities helps you gauge competitiveness:
| City | Avg. Digital Marketing Salary (2026) |
|---|---|
| Oklahoma City, OK | $55,000 – $73,000 |
| Dallas, TX | $60,000 – $80,000 |
| Austin, TX | $62,000 – $85,000 |
| Kansas City, MO | $58,000 – $75,000 |
Oklahoma City offers slightly lower salaries compared to tech hubs such as Austin or Dallas, yet its lower cost of living makes the compensation attractive for professionals seeking affordable urban living.
